Tuition and Financial Aid Information

The Elmwood Franklin tuition is a graduated fee structure that is \"all inclusive.\" This means there are no additional charges for books and supplies, computers and science labs, outdoor education, local special events and field trips, individual and class pictures, and professional-quality yearbooks. Nutritious lunches and snacks are also included in the tuition. These expenses, at some schools, could total as much as $3,500 per year.

Tuition Assistance
In this day of economic uncertainty and rising costs, it can be difficult to imagine factoring an Elmwood Franklin tuition into the family budget. But often, with financial assistance and planning, an EFS education can become a reality. No student should fail to apply to Elmwood Franklin solely because of financial considerations. While no student receives full tuition assistance, EFS remains committed to providing financial help to families of qualified students who otherwise could not attend our school. In fact, more than 30 percent of our current families receive financial aid.

For more information about this program, please contact the Admissions Office at 877-5035 or admissions@elmwoodfranklin.org for a Tuition Assistance Packet.

You may begin to apply for financial aid starting on November 1, as described below. To be eligible for consideration for financial aid at Elmwood Franklin School, you must complete your application by the end of February. We will communicate decisions about financial aid at the end of March when we send out our acceptance contracts.

We use School and Student Services (SSS) to process financial aid applications. SSS is a service of the National Association of Independent Schools. Based on the financial information you provide, SSS gives us an estimated amount your family can contribute to educational expenses. This helps us make fair and objective financial aid decisions.
